This Shrimp & Lemon Pappardelle recipe is the perfect elegant dish for Valentine’s Day. Let’s get started!
Ingredients for Shrimp & Lemon Pappardelle:
- 8.8 oz (250g) pappardelle pasta;
- 10.5 oz (300g) medium shrimp, peeled and deveined;
- Juice and zest of 1 Sicilian lemon;
- 2 garlic cloves, minced;
- ½ small onion, diced;
- ½ cup dry white wine;
- ½ cup heavy cream;
- 2 tbsp unsalted butter;
- 2 tbsp extra-virgin olive oil;
- Salt and black pepper to taste;
- Grated Parmesan cheese for garnish;
- Fresh basil leaves for decoration.
How to prepare Shrimp & Lemon Pappardelle:
- Bring salted water to a boil in a large pot and cook pappardelle until al dente;
- Drain and set aside;
- In a large skillet, heat olive oil over medium-high heat;
- Add shrimp and season with salt and pepper;
- Cook shrimp for about 2 minutes per side until pink, then remove and set aside;
- In the same skillet, add butter and more olive oil;
- Sauté garlic and onion until tender and aromatic;
- Pour in white wine and let it reduce slightly;
- Add lemon juice and zest, stirring well;
- Reduce heat to medium-low and incorporate heavy cream;
- Mix until the sauce thickens and is smooth, then season with salt and pepper;
- Return shrimp to the skillet and add cooked pappardelle;
- Gently toss to coat everything in the sauce;
- Serve in individual plates, topped with grated Parmesan and fresh basil. Enjoy!
